How to Make Bright & Buttery Lemon Cream Snowball
Step 1: Prepare the Lemon Cream Mixture
Start by zesting and juicing fresh lemons to capture their bright essence. Whisk the lemon juice, zest, sugar, and softened butter together until smooth and light, creating the foundation of your snowball’s signature flavor.
Step 2: Whip the Cream
In a separate bowl, whip the heavy cream and vanilla extract until soft peaks form. This whipped cream will add airy texture and lighten the richness of the butter mixture.
Step 3: Fold Cream into Lemon Mixture
Carefully fold the whipped cream into the lemon and butter base, preserving the fluffiness while integrating the flavors. This gentle action ensures a light, snowball-like texture.
Step 4: Chill the Mixture
Transfer the mixture into serving dishes or molds and refrigerate for at least two hours. Chilling allows the flavors to meld and the texture to set perfectly.
Step 5: Serve and Garnish
Before serving, dust the top with confectioners’ sugar for that classic snowball look and add optional garnishes like lemon slices or fresh herbs for visual appeal and extra zing.

Bright & Buttery Lemon Cream Snowball
Bright & Buttery Lemon Cream Snowball is a luscious dessert that perfectly balances the vibrant zest of fresh lemons with a rich, creamy buttery texture. Soft, fluffy, and melt-in-your-mouth, this easy-to-make treat is ideal for anytime indulgence or special occasions, featuring a refreshing citrus punch and smooth creaminess in every bite.
- Total Time: 2 hours 15 minutes
- Yield: 6 servings 1x
Ingredients
Core Ingredients
- 2 tablespoons fresh lemon juice (about 1–2 lemons)
- 1 teaspoon lemon zest (freshly grated)
- 1/2 cup unsalted butter, softened
- 3/4 cup granulated sugar
- 1 cup heavy cream
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- Confectioners’ sugar, for dusting
Instructions
- Prepare the Lemon Cream Mixture: Zest and juice fresh lemons to capture their bright essence. In a mixing bowl, whisk together the lemon juice, lemon zest, granulated sugar, and softened butter until the mixture is smooth, light, and well combined, forming the foundation of the snowball flavor.
- Whip the Cream: In a separate chilled bowl, whip the heavy cream together with the vanilla extract until soft peaks form. This whipped cream will add an airy texture and lighten the buttery richness.
- Fold Cream into Lemon Mixture: Gently fold the whipped cream into the lemon and butter base, taking care to preserve the fluffiness. This delicate folding ensures a light, melt-in-your-mouth snowball texture.
- Chill the Mixture: Transfer the combined mixture into serving dishes or molds. Refrigerate for at least two hours to allow the flavors to meld and the texture to set firmly.
- Serve and Garnish: Before serving, dust the top generously with confectioners’ sugar to create a classic snowy appearance. Optionally, garnish with thin lemon slices, freshly grated lemon zest, or edible flower petals for added elegance and extra zest.
Notes
- Use freshly squeezed lemon juice and zest for the best bright citrus flavor and to avoid bitterness.
- Ensure butter is softened but not melted to achieve a smooth and creamy texture.
- Whip the heavy cream just until soft peaks form to maintain lightness.
- Fold the cream gently to preserve the snowball’s fluffy texture without overmixing.
- Chill thoroughly for at least two hours for optimal flavor melding and texture setting.
